Indian cricket team's coach to be finalised on 10th July.

Cricket is deemed as religion in India. Everything related to it certainly becomes a national issue. As Indian cricket team is looking for it's new coach after Anil Kumble, apparently due to his spat with the current captain of the team Virat Kohli, resigned from the esteemed post just few days before his contract as coach was about to end, applicants have started applying for the job from around the world. Ravi Shastri, former Indian player and Former director, Indian cricket team notably the front runner to get selected for the post ended any speculation whatsoever about whether he will apply for the post or not and handed over his CV to the concerned authorities on 3rd of July. Virender Sehwag, Tom Moody, Richard Pybus, Phil Simmons are the few other probables to get selected for this esteemed post. ICC Women's world cup, 2017 - Australia gets better of India, wins the match by 8 wickets

Mag Lanning and Ellyse Perry gave an unbeaten stand of 124 runs to help Australia beat India in a league stage by 8 wickets.  Australia won the toss and asked India to bat first. India once again had a bad start with Mandhana getting out for just 3 runs. After the brilliant start in the tournament, Mandhana has not cashed into her form and today it was the fourth consecutive time that she got out without getting into the double figures.  Mithali Raj came into bat after the fall of first wicket and continued with her sublime form in the tournament. She along with Raut started to move the scoreboard along.  Raut was looking in great form and was hitting the ball very nicely. India Vs Pakistan - History as it has been in ICC Champions Trophy

                                  "Nothing can get better then this" If you are a cricket lover, this would certainly be your thought for the cricket match lined up on this Sunday, India vs Pakistan, final of the ICC Champions Trophy, 2017. Whenever the two teams play against each other plenty of emotions flow on the day. Happiness and celebrations at one side of the LOC and grief and pain on the other. Firework shows at one side and TV crashing at the other.                                                                                            Pakistan thumped host England in the first semifinal and India gave the same treatment to Bangladesh in the other. It would be safe to say that both teams cakewalked into the finals. Now, the two teams will face off in a final to get their hands to the second most coveted trophy of one day cricket after World Cup.
